    If you weren't around when the celebrated civil rights meeting place Paschal's sold 50-cent sweet tea and $2 fried chicken sandwiches, Saturday will be like 1970 all over again. The historic downtown Atlanta restaurant is part of Peacock's Aug. 24 promotion of its upcoming Atlanta-filmed series Fight Night: Million Dollar Heist, starring Kevin Hart, Samuel L. Jackson, Taraji P. Jenson. Don Cheadle and Terrence Howard, which premieres on Sept. 5.

    May 24 at Symphony Hall, the Atlanta Jazz Festival presents WCLK At 50 featuring Lil John Roberts with an Atlanta All-Star Band - and such an occasion doesn't merit the usual "one-two."The event is co-produced by Roberts and WCLK hosts Jamal Ahmad and Ray Cornelius, and WCLK At 50's 90-minute set list will span from the 1930s and the classic jazz era ("Maiden Voyage" written by Herbie Hancock, "Take 5" by Dave Brubeck) through today.

    “Hip-hop pioneer” absolutely describes Rico Wade. His contributions to the group with the best-selling rap album of all time — OutKast’s “Speakerboxxx/The Love Below” — are enough on their own to earn Wade, an Atlanta original we lost April 13, that qualifier.
